Foundation Assessment in Sarasota, FL
Foundation assessment services involve a thorough evaluation of a property's structural foundation to identify potential issues or areas of concern. These assessments typically cover residential homes, including slab foundations, pier and beam systems, and basement structures. Property owners often seek this service when they notice signs such as uneven flooring, cracks in walls or ceilings, or doors and windows that no longer close properly. Understanding the current condition of the foundation can help determine whether repairs are needed and inform the next steps for maintaining the property's stability.

Common Foundation Assessment Jobs
Foundation Inspection - a thorough assessment to identify existing foundation issues and structural concerns.
Settlement Evaluation - analysis of soil movement and its impact on the stability of the foundation.
Crack Monitoring - tracking and measuring foundation cracks to determine if they are worsening.
Drainage Assessment - evaluation of water flow around the property to prevent foundation damage.
Soil Testing - examination of soil conditions to understand their effect on foundation stability.
Structural Analysis - review of the foundation's condition to support repair or reinforcement decisions.
Foundation Assessment Questions
What is a foundation assessment? It is an evaluation of a property's foundation to identify issues such as cracks, settling, or movement that could affect stability.
When should a foundation assessment be considered? Signs like uneven floors, cracked walls, or doors that won't close properly may indicate the need for an assessment.
What types of properties typically need foundation assessments? Both residential homes and commercial buildings can benefit from assessments if there are concerns about structural integrity.
What issues can a foundation assessment reveal? Common findings include foundation settling, cracks, moisture problems, or other structural concerns affecting the property's stability.
